Janet Marlene (Sherwood) Holst, 92, of Indianapolis, Indiana, passed away peacefully on Saturday, June 28, 2025. She was born on August 21, 1932, in Ogden, Utah, to the late William and Zella (Robinson) Sherwood.
Janet graduated from Ogden High School and began her career at Hill Air Force Base, where she met the love of her life, Airman Donald L. Holst. They married on September 26, 1953, beginning a lifelong partnership that lasted more than 70 years.
After Don’s service in Korea, the couple lived in California before settling in Don’s hometown of Lafayette, Indiana. There, they built a warm and welcoming home that became the center of many cherished family gatherings and celebrations.
While living in Lafayette, Janet worked at Alcoa, was a stay-at-home mom, and later served as Executive Assistant to the president of First Federal Savings and Loan. She also supported Don in his travel agency business.
In retirement, Janet and Don split their time between Indiana and Florida, where they enjoyed golf, card games, and community life in Ruskin. They eventually returned to Indiana to be closer to their family.
Janet had a deep love for exercising, reading, playing the piano, and traveling. She was admired for her strength, her elegance, and her unwavering devotion to those she loved.
